What Does 313 Mean In Detroit?

313 is actually the area code for Detroit, Michigan, a place known for its rappers and “difficult” interior. The most famous rapper to use this slang is Eminem where he made a song titled “313” that references his hardship, skills, and experiences in Detroit.

Why Detroit is called 313?

In the 2002 film 8 Mile, featuring the artist, the 313 area code is mentioned multiple times, because of the film’s setting in Detroit. Eminem’s character, B–Rabbit, and his friends call their group “three one third”, their nickname for the area code.

What state is 313 area code?

Area code 313 is a Michigan area code that covers the city of Detroit. Michigan has area codes of 231, 248, 269, 313, 517, 586, 616, 679, 734, 810, 906, 947, 989.

What city is 8 Mile in?

Detroit
The movie 8 Mile hit theaters in fall 2002. Ever since, people from all over the world can identify the name of at least one Detroit street. The semi-autobiographical hip hop biopic tells the story of a young white rapper named Jimmy “B-Rabbit” Smith Jr. (Eminem) who is trying to make it in Detroit in 1995.

What is the meaning of 8 Mile?

Edit. What is the film’s title a reference to? 8 Mile is a reference to 8 Mile Road, a highway that cuts through Metro Detroit. For several decades, 8 Mile Road has become a major dividing line as it has separated the predominantly black city of Detroit from its wealthier, and predominantly white, northern suburbs.

Is Detroit a real place?

Detroit (/dɪˈtrɔɪt/, locally also /ˈdiːtrɔɪt/; French: Détroit, lit. ‘strait’) is the largest city in the U.S. state of Michigan. It is also the largest U.S. city on the United States–Canada border, and the seat of government of Wayne County.

Why is Detroit so famous?

Nicknamed ‘Motor City’, it’s best known as the birthplace of the modern automobile, with visitors flocking to the infamous Henry Ford Experience. However, Detroit is much more than just automobiles, thanks to a thriving art, music, sports, and nightlife scene.

What is 8miles Detroit?

Eight Mile exists as a physical dividing line, as well as a de-facto psychological and cultural boundary for the region. As the northern border to the City of Detroit, Eight Mile separates the city’s predominately African American urban core from the more white suburbs to the north.

Why is Eminem called Jimmy?

The way Marshall Mathers got his rap moniker is rather simple, his initials M.M., or, Eminem. In 8 Mile you find out that Em’s character Jimmy got his stage name from a childhood nickname. His mom started calling him “Bunny Rabbit,” because he had big ears and buck teeth as a kid and the name stuck around.
